22 Abbotsfield, Cannock, WS11 4NP is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 861 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£216,937 , which equates to approximately £252 per square foot. It was last sold on 27 Feb 2015 for £128,500. Since then, the value has increased by £88,437, representing a 68.8% increase, or approximately 6.4% per year.

The current estimated value of £216,937 is:

  • 13.4% higher than the average property price on Abbotsfield
  • 13.8% higher than the average in the WS11 4NP postcode area
  • and 20.0% lower than the average price for Cannock as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ded once as rented and once as owner-occupied, indicating a change in how it was used over time.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 2 December 2024, the property was recorded as rented.

22 Abbotsfield, Cannock, Cannock Chase, Staffordshire, WS11 4NP has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 2 Dec 2024.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 17 Jul 2014. The rating of C rem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 1.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 250 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The wall energy efficiency changing from good to average, with the construction or insulation remaining cavity wall, filled cavity.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 58%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to good.
